Brain Imaging Outreach Working Group

Committee Mission

The Brain Imaging Outreach Working Group focuses on increasing awareness among neurologists and other referring physicians about FDG, SPECT, dopamine transporter imaging, amyloid and tau imaging, and FET PET imaging and their appropriate uses, providing updated patient materials for the website and all patient education events, and educating legislators, regulatory officials, and funding bodies.

Committee Charges

  • Propose sessions at relevant society meetings:
    • Alzheimer’s Association International Conference
    • International Neuropsychology Society Annual Meeting
    • American Association of Geriatric Psychiatry
  • Create slideshow on Diagnosing Memory Disorders for use in the Local Outreach Library
  • Develop a “How to Better Understand Your Imaging Report” Factsheet on Amyloid Imaging
